Thank you for testing! This is consistent with what Aaron and I
experienced. So there is an issue with basing the CPU off Nehalem (in
combination with the kvm_pv_unhalt flag), but basing off kvm64 seems to
work just fine :)

If you'd like to further test, please use

qm set <ID> -args '-cpu
qemu64,+aes,enforce,+kvm_pv_eoi,+kvm_pv_unhalt,+pni,+popcnt,+sse4.1,+sse4.2,+ssse3'

as that's the default proposed in the latest version.


With those flags Debian 11 installs on Ryzen 1700, 2600X and 5950X have been flawless. Will leave VMs on for a couple of days just in case.
